Preventing Plaque and Tartar Buildup
Plaque is a sticky film of bacteria that forms on your teeth daily. When not removed effectively, it hardens into tartar, which brushing and flossing alone can’t eliminate. Plaque and tartar accumulate on the teeth and gumline, increasing the risk of decay and gum disease. During a professional cleaning, dental hygienists use specialized tools to remove this buildup, helping to prevent cavities and protect your enamel. Regular cleanings keep plaque and tartar at bay, ensuring that your mouth stays healthy and free of decay-causing bacteria.
Reducing the Risk of Gum Disease
Gum disease, also known as periodontal disease, starts as gingivitis and can progress if left untreated. Semi-annual cleanings help to prevent gum disease by removing the plaque and tartar that irritate your gums and cause inflammation. Early signs of gum disease include redness, swelling, and bleeding gums. Regular cleanings allow your dentist to detect and address these symptoms early, preventing the progression to more serious conditions such as periodontitis, which can lead to tooth loss. By attending cleanings twice a year, you reduce the risk of gum disease and ensure that your gums stay healthy and supportive of your teeth.
Detecting Potential Problems Early
Semi-annual cleanings also provide a valuable opportunity for your dentist to examine your mouth for early signs of potential issues, such as cavities, oral cancer, or misalignment. Catching problems early allows for more straightforward, less costly treatments. For example, a small cavity can be treated with a simple filling, while untreated decay can lead to more complex procedures, like root canals or crowns. Regular check-ups during your cleaning help your dentist monitor any changes in your mouth, ensuring that issues are managed before they become significant.
Freshening Breath and Enhancing Smile Appearance
Beyond health benefits, semi-annual cleanings contribute to a fresher, brighter smile. Plaque and tartar buildup can cause bad breath and discoloration, making your teeth appear dull. Professional cleanings polish your teeth, removing surface stains and refreshing your breath. Leaving the dentist with a clean, polished smile boosts your confidence and encourages better oral hygiene habits.
Maintaining Your Overall Health
The benefits of regular cleanings extend beyond oral health. Studies have shown links between gum disease and conditions such as heart disease, diabetes, and respiratory infections. By reducing your risk of gum disease, semi-annual cleanings support your overall health and reduce the potential for complications related to bacteria entering the bloodstream.
